  • Adaptation Displacement: Did you know that Mumfie was originally a series of books created by Katherine Tozer in the 1930's?
  • Big-Lipped Alligator Moment: In-universe example in the episode "A Royal Mis-Understanding", when the Queen of Night is visited by people who want to marry her because Mumfie thought that losing your heart meant that you needed to love another person, but it turned out that the Queen actually lost her heart shaped locket. The narrator even lampshades that the Queen was unaware that she would be visited by people who wanted to marry her.
  • Ensemble Dark Horse: Most fans seem to love Scarecrow more than any other character.
  • Foreshadowing: In the song "The Chase", one of the lyrics is "The Admiral and chums will soon be safely locked inside a cell!" Many minutes later, Mumfie gets trapped inside a holding cell on The Secretary of Night's island.
